Kings took it to the Caps on Sunday resulting in a hard working 6-3 victory.
Drew Dorantes got them off to a scintillating start when he stole a puck on the penalty kill and raced to the Cowichan goal to score shorthanded at 6:42.
Matt Scarth, in his first game back, made it 2-0 at 9:09 on a nice deflection of Luko's shot and then Ryan Scarfo made it 3-0 at 19:11 on a nice powerplay passing play from Rideout and Dorantes.
Cowichan mustered a couple of goals in the second to close the gap to 3-2 after two periods but the Kings roared back in the third.
Dorantes made it 4-2 at 0:59 and then Luke Norgard followed Scarth in on a two on one and stuffed in a rebound at 3:33.
Caps made 5-3 on the powerplay three minutes later but Scarth put it away with a powerplay goal at 13:17 and a 6-3 final.
A complete 60 for the Kings in their second game of the weekend and a solid win for Imoo with 29 saves on 32 shots.
